The man behind Grey Goose, Francois Thibault, learnt his spirit making skills in the Cognac region and more than the odd eye brow was raised when he moved to making Vodka. The vodka is indeed made in France but has gone on to be a huge international success. Within each and every bottle of Grey Goose is the essence of the finest ingredients France has to offer: Soft winter wheat harvested from in and around Picardy, plus the purest spring water from Gensac in the Cognac region.Lovingly cared for and captured from field to bottle in a process exclusive to Grey Goose Vodka.
